Abstract

Health problems in pregnant women, both physically and psychologically have an impact on the quality of life of the mother. During the Covid-19 pandemic, as many as 83.9% of basic health services could not run optimally, especially posyandu. This certainly has a huge impact on maternal and child health services, especially pregnant women with high-risk pregnancies. The purpose of the study was to determine the quality of life of pregnant women with high-risk pregnancies during the Covid-19 pandemic. This research method is descriptive analytic with a cross-sectional approach. Data was collected using the World Health Organization Quality of Life (WHOQOL)-BREF questionnaire. The number of subjects in this study were 70 pregnant women with high risk. The results showed that most of the quality of life of pregnant women with high-risk pregnancies during the Covid-19 pandemic had a low quality of life. In addition, there are several factors related to the quality of life during pregnancy during the Covid-19 pandemic, namely education, employment and economic status
